Cost Tiles Vs Polished Concrete. Polished concrete flooring costs between $1,500 and $3,900, with an average price of $2,700. Polished concrete is more durable than tile, easier to clean, and surprisingly affordable. You'll get a shiny, seamless floor uninterrupted by tile grout lines. Is polished concrete cheaper than tiles? Yes, polished concrete floors are cheaper than tiles. This type of flooring is a stylish, modern, and relatively inexpensive option.
